For automated insulin delivery with the mylife YpsoPump, you need the mylife CamAPS FX app and the Dexcom G6 or FreeStyle Libre 3 PLUS CGM. Connect the mylife CamAPS FX app to the insulin pump and sensor. The sensor sends glucose data every minute (FreeStyle Libre 3 PLUS) or every five minutes (Dexcom G6) to the mylife CamAPS FX app. Based on those readings, the app adjusts insulin delivery on the insulin pump every eight to twelve minutes to prevent low and high glucose levels.
The mylife CamAPS FX app is personalised and adaptive; it constantly learns and quickly adapts to ever changing insulin needs. It adjusts to diurnal and day-to-day variations in insulin requirements and compensates for over and under-dosing of the meal bolus. For increased privacy and convenience, you are able to deliver a meal bolus directly from your smartphone.
The mylife CamAPS FX app is approved for people with type 1 diabetes aged one year and over, including pregnant women. Approved for people with type 1 diabetes aged two years and over when used in combination with Dexcom G6 or aged four years and over when used in combination with FreeStyle Libre 3 PLUS.
The learning takes place on three levels:
Overall learning:
This learning is based on the body’s overall insulin need; the insulin needed on average and during the day.
Diurnal learning (over 24 hours):
This learning is based on how much insulin is needed for a specific hour in a day.
Post-meal learning:
When the user delivers a meal bolus, the system will observe whether the insulin amount was appropriate. If a user constantly over or underestimates carbohydrates, the system will start to adjust insulin delivery post-meal.
All these learnings are occurring continuously.
